To all branch managers: Project Silverhatch, our new stock-allocation platform, will not launch on the planned date. Migration testing at the Corwith hub surfaced data-mapping errors that require careful remediation, and we will not rush a fix that risks branch operations. Revised go-live is expected roughly ten weeks out; interim procedures remain in force, and Marta Quillen's team will circulate updated training materials. Please reassure staff that no roles are affected. For managers' eyes only, the related planning note follows below.

internal memo for yahag-hahig: Belwynix Group plans to lower the Silir list price by 62 percent in May.

The request covers fleet renewal, depot maintenance at the Wrenhollow and Castermoor sites, and expanded driver training. Operations has prioritised items by safety impact and expected cost recovery, with fleet renewal ranked first. Contingency has been trimmed to keep the total within the envelope signalled by the executive committee. Approval is expected at the March review. The investment rationale supporting this request is detailed in the confidential note below.

management briefing: The renewal with Zoraelax Group closes at $10 million a year, 15 percent below the last contract. Project Ralael slips by six weeks because of the audit delay.

**Cold starts on Bramblehook handlers.** If you're seeing 8–10 second latencies after quiet periods, that's the runtime spinning up fresh containers. Quick fix: bump the `warmPoolSize` in the Bramblehook console to 3 and the pre-warmer will keep instances hot. If latency persists, the pre-warmer itself may be failing auth against the scheduler API — check its logs for 401s. To re-authenticate the pre-warmer manually, call the scheduler endpoint using the bearer token below.

bearer token for bajef-yagap: eyJhbGciOiJIUzI1NiIsInR5cCI6IkpXVCJ9.eyJzdWIiOiISx5vUAfqCBIn0.VoNF_nOW3W-u